The National Low Income Housing Coalition is dedicated solely to achieving socially just public policy that assures people with the lowest incomes in the United States have affordable and decent homes.      

We hope you will use our website to learn more about housing affordability in your community and nationally, and to help you take action for better and more affordable housing choices.
